GGD area
An area in which the municipal mental health care services cooperate.
Country of birth
The country where someone was born.
Standardised income
The disposable income corrected for differences in household size and composition.
Worker (agriculture)
Term used in the agriculture survey for someone working in an agricultural business.
Round trip flight
Flight that takes off and lands at the same airport.
Bus
Motor vehicle equipped for transporting nine or more passengers (excl. driver).
Commercial air transport
All paid passenger, cargo or mail transport by air.
Area for the extraction of minerals
Area used for extracting minerals from the soil.
Physical energy units
Cubic metres, litres, kilograms, kilowatt hours for measuring quantities of energy.
Person with a western migration background
Person originating from a country in Europe (excluding Turkey), North America and Oceania, or from Indonesia or Japan.
Natural increase
The number of live births minus the number of deaths within a given period.
Cargo weight
Applies to the gross weight or the gross-gross weight of goods.
Owner of a driver's license for cars
In possession of a driver's licence for cars.
Municipal population register
A computerised population register used by the municipalities.
Central Product Classification (CPC)
Classification of goods and services recommended by the United Nations.
Definitive verdict
Verdict by a judge to which there are no normal legal remedies open.
Wages earned
The wages employees earn (as opposed to collective labour agreement wages).
Departure
Removal from the municipal population register because of a move to another municipality or another country.
Housing area
Area primarily intended for housing, incl. primary housing facilities.
Thrombosis service laboratory
Part of a doctors' or clinical chemical laboratory specialising in thrombosis activities.
Crime
Actions and behaviour (both active and by omission) which are punishable by law.
Grid
Square of 500x500 metres with coordinates at 500 and 1000 metres according to the RD system.
Disposable income (net)
Income after deduction of taxes, plus benefits, that is spent on consumption and savings.
